Victorian Lyric Opera Company presents "The Sorcerer"
Description: 2 performances | August 31 and September 2 at 8pm
The rich but witless Alexis is recently betrothed to the beautiful Aline. After having a vision, he plots to bring the joy of marriage to the entire town at his wedding ceremony. Alexis calls in the old family sorcerer, Jonathan Wellington Wells to concoct the perfect love potion. Naturally, this backfires and hilarity ensues.
The Sorcerer will be presented in conjunction with The 7th Great Gilbert and Sullivan Sing Out. Those participating in the Sing Out do not need to purchase a ticket to this performance. Entry is included with your registration fee.
Presented in semi-staged concert format with full orchestra.
